Output 7566dbbf1263882d3cf26d0a4bd07a91b7c5943e7cb6df039c6522beaa31b135:0

value
24967766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17bc28f346dcc84241050562184e7a9e89866666 OP_EQUALVERIFY OP_CHECKSIG
address
13AVwzjjeUbyYjp6sTPBFTYoJyeRv7nLKu
transaction
7566dbbf1263882d3cf26d0a4bd07a91b7c5943e7cb6df039c6522beaa31b135
spent
true